Samsung Galaxy Z Flip Display Controversy: Glass or Plastic?

Galaxy Z Flip leaked

At Galaxy unpacked Event, Samsung said, we have launched the world’s first foldable phone with the glass display panel and this is what most of the people bought it but recently JeryRigEverything did a Durability Test test of Galaxy Z Flip and its tuns on Samsung didn’t use 100% glass panel? TO know more you can watch the video,

As you have seen, the used glass is not that great because it can be screeched through nails, so the question is what kind of glass they have used for this $1,380 Galaxy Z Flip?.

After JeryRigEverything uploaded a video on YouTube, Samsung also shared a video and they said, we have used a protective layer on top of the glass panel for security reasons like what they have done with Galaxy Fold.

Now the question is if someone removed the layer or somehow that layer damages then what will happen to Galaxy Z flip?, for now, Samsung didn’t clear the answer but if anything comes up then it will be updated.
